FGL Announces Small Sin City Residency

A Las Vegas residency for Florida Georgia Line is set to start next December.

(Las Vegas, NV)  --  Florida Georgia Line is announcing a limited residency in Las Vegas. 

The country music duo will headline five shows in Sin City in early December. 

They'll all take place at Zappos Theater at Planet Hollywood Resort and Casino. 

Mason Ramsey will open the shows.
